The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of George Baker, born in 1853 in Brewood, Staffordshire, consisted of 6 members. George was the head of the household, married to Mary Ann Baker, born in 1851 in Shifnal, Shropshire, England. They had 3 children; Harold (born 1878 in Wolverhampton, Staffordshire, England), Maud (born 1880 in Wolverhampton, Staffordshire, England) and Gertrude (born 1881 in Wolverhampton, Staffordshire, England).
During the period, also present in the household was George's Servant, Sarah Ann Jones, born in 1863 in Wolverhampton, Staffordshire, England.
